SymbolsTrumpf
Trumpf is a German-based manufacturer that has been at the forefront of laser cutting technology for decades. The company offers a wide range of laser cutting machines, including CO2 and fiber laser systems. Trumpf's laser cutters are known for their high precision and reliability, making them a popular choice for industrial applications. With a strong global presence and a reputation for quality, Trumpf is a leading player in the laser cutter market.
SymbolsBystronic
Bystronic is another major player in the laser cutter market, with a focus on innovation and technology. The Swiss-based company offers a range of laser cutting machines, including fiber and CO2 systems. Bystronic's laser cutters are known for their speed and efficiency, making them a popular choice for businesses looking to increase productivity. With a strong emphasis on research and development, Bystronic continues to push the boundaries of laser cutting technology.
SymbolsAmada
Amada is a Japanese manufacturer that has a strong presence in the laser cutter market. The company offers a range of laser cutting machines, including fiber and CO2 systems. Amada's laser cutters are known for their durability and performance, making them a popular choice for a wide range of industries. With a focus on customer satisfaction and continuous improvement, Amada remains a key player in the competitive landscape of laser cutter manufacturers.
SymbolsMazak
Mazak is a global leader in the manufacturing industry, with a diverse range of products including laser cutting machines. The company offers a variety of laser cutting systems, from entry-level models to high-end machines for advanced applications. Mazak's laser cutters are known for their precision and cutting-edge technology, making them a top choice for businesses looking to invest in quality equipment. With a strong focus on innovation and customer service, Mazak continues to be a major player in the laser cutter market.
SymbolsHan's Laser
Han's Laser is a Chinese manufacturer that has made a name for itself in the laser cutter market. The company offers a wide range of laser cutting machines, from affordable entry-level systems to high-end models for industrial use. Han's Laser's laser cutters are known for their reliability and performance, making them a popular choice for businesses of all sizes. With a strong focus on research and development, Han's Laser continues to expand its presence in the competitive landscape of laser cutter manufacturers.
